Verifying Your Identity - How does it work.

We’re always working on creating a secure platform for everyone. That’s why, before booking a reservation, we ask for a government ID and have you confirm your legal name and add your address. This information helps us keep StayInBoise.com secure, fight fraud, and more.


Verifying your identity with StayInBoise.com

When you’re asked to confirm your identity, you’ll need to add your legal name and address to your booking and photo of a government ID (driver’s license, passport, or national identity card). Additionally, you may be asked to take a brand-new selfie photo of yourself.

If you're asked to take a photo of yourself, it needs to match the photo on your ID, and your ID must be valid. If your photos don’t match, if you’re under 25, or your ID doesn't appear to be valid, you won't be able to book a reservation on StayInBoise.com. If you’re under 25, all current reservations will also be canceled.

Options for verifying your identity:

Take a photo of your ID using your cell phone
Take a photo using the camera on your computer or mobile device
Upload an existing photo of your ID
Add your legal first and last name to your reservation at check-out
Add your address (this should match where you get banking documents or utility bills)

Types of Identification

Your ID needs to be an official government-issued ID (not an ID for a school, library, gym, etc.) that includes a photo of you. Depending on your location and what country you’re from, you may be able to add one of the following types of government ID:

  • Driver’s license - If you add a driver’s license, you’ll be asked for two photos—one of the front of the license and one of the back.
  • Passport - If you add a passport, make sure the photo includes the numbers located at the bottom of the page with your picture.
  • National identity card

Other ways identification info may be used

When you and other guests provide identification info it builds trust in our platform. It also helps us keep StayInBoise.com secure, fight fraud, and more. There are a few ways that identification info may be used to do this.

First, we may use your identification info to better protect all guests and staff. The information helps us check that everyone is who they say they are—and therefore, we can do an even better job of keeping fraudulent individuals away from StayInBoise.com. We can also keep accounts more secure, and better determine that everyone who uses StayInBoise.com is over 25 years old.

Additionally, where permitted by applicable law, we may provide identification info from a government ID, such as a full name, address, and date of birth, to our service providers to run background checks against public records for criminal convictions and sex offender registrations.

Also, where permitted by applicable law, we may provide certain identification info to banks and other financial institutions (which helps them enforce various tax, anti-money laundering, and sanctions laws), as well as to law enforcement agencies (who may be conducting investigations requiring StayInBoise’s involvement).

Our goal is to work closely with these organizations and comply with our legal obligations, while also ensuring the respect, privacy, and security of everyone who uses our platform.

Troubleshooting

If you’re having difficulty submitting your government ID, here are a few things to keep in mind:

  • Check your email inbox, text messages, and phone notifications: You may have been sent additional information. Check your SPAM inbox for messages as they may sometimes be sent there.
  • Provide high-quality JPG or PNG files: Take photos in a well-lit room, and fit all information within the photos frame. Make sure that the image isn’t blurry or obscured.
  • Submit photos of an original (not photocopied) and undamaged ID: If the ID has two sides, like a driver's license or national ID card, make sure that you submit each side—one of the front and one of the back.
  • When taking a selfie photo of yourself, make sure the photo shows your face including eyes, nose and mouth and fits within the photos frame
